Exploring the Captivating World of Acid Music: A Tribute to Famous Acid Music in the UK

Introduction: Music has always been a powerful tool for expressing emotions, pushing boundaries, and shaping cultural movements. One such genre that emerged during the late 1980s and early 1990s was acid music. Originating from the underground club scene in Chicago, this unique style of electronic music quickly found its way across the pond, gaining immense popularity in the United Kingdom. In this blog post, we pay homage to the influential acid music movement in the UK, exploring the iconic tracks and artists that propelled this genre to new heights. 1. The Birth of Acid Music: To understand the impact of acid music in the UK, it's crucial to acknowledge its roots in Chicago's budding electronic music scene. Developed by artists like DJ Pierre and the group Phuture, acid music was characterized by its distinctive synthesized "acid" sound produced using the Roland TB-303 bassline synthesizer. This revolutionary instrument laid the foundation for the entire genre and would go on to shape the UK acid music movement. 2. The UKs Infatuation with Acid Music: During the late 1980s, acid music began to infiltrate the UK club scene, resonating with young and adventurous music enthusiasts. Legendary clubs like Shoom and Trip played a pivotal role in popularizing acid music to the masses. Acid house parties became a cultural phenomenon, attracting droves of fans and creating an atmosphere of euphoria and togetherness. 3. Iconic Acid Music Tracks: Acid music in the UK birthed some timeless tracks that continue to inspire and energize listeners to this day. One such example is Phuture's "Acid Tracks," hailed as the track that started it all. The hypnotic beats and mind-bending acid sounds created a blueprint for future acid music productions in the UK. Other influential tracks include Baby Ford's "Oochy Coochy" and A Guy Called Gerald's "Voodoo Ray," which showcased the genre's versatility and popularity. 4. Acid Music Producers and DJs: Behind every great genre is a lineup of talented artists who push the boundaries and create magic. The UK acid music movement boasted exceptional producers and DJs who catapulted the genre to unprecedented heights. Artists like Adamski, 808 State, and the Orb made significant contributions to the development and evolution of acid music, infusing their unique styles and sounds into the mix. 5. Acid Music's Enduring Legacy: The impact of acid music in the UK cannot be underestimated. It not only redefined the electronic music landscape but also left a lasting legacy on the nation's rave and dance culture. The genre's influence continues to be felt in contemporary electronic music, with many artists and producers incorporating acid-inspired elements in their compositions. Conclusion: Acid music may have originated in the underground clubs of Chicago, but it was the UK that provided a fertile ground for its growth and reinvention. From the infectious energy of acid house parties to the iconic tracks that captured the hearts of a generation, the UK acid music movement represents an exhilarating chapter in music history. As we look back at its enduring legacy, we can appreciate its role in shaping the vibrant electronic music scene we enjoy today.
